WB Group D Exam Date and Exam Scheme Pattern


WRITTEN EXAMINATION: - Full Marks : 85;

The Written Examination will have 85 Multiple Choice (Four choices) Objective Type Questions (MCQs) carrying 1 mark each. The duration of the examination will be One and a half hours. Question in the Written Examination shall be in the following subjects (of class VIII standard of West Bengal Board of Secondary Education):-

A. General Studies - 40 Marks (40 questions)

B. Language Paper (Bengali/ Nepali/ Hindi/ Urdu) - 10 Marks (10 questions)

C. Elementary Mathematics - 35 Marks (35 questions)
EXAM DATE AND TINE : 14TH May , 12 noon to 1:30 pm 

“There will be negative marking for the wrong answer and ½ marks will be deducted for every wrong answer”.

MCQ type questions will be set from both old and new syllabus of class VIII standard of West Bengal Board of Secondary Education.

The candidates are expected to fill up the correct blank space against a question no. on the OMR Answer Sheet. The Question Paper for General Studies and Mathematics will be in English and Bengali, but the Answers will have to be filled up correctly in OMR Sheet.

Note: - There will be no negative marking for any wrong answer. West Bengal Group D Recruitment Board will decide the prescribed scheme and syllabus for the Written Examination. The qualifying marks in the Written Examination will be fixed by the West Bengal Group D Recruitment Board.
